There are several reasons why studying operations management can be beneficial. Here are some of the key reasons why you should consider studying this subject:
- Operations management is an essential part of running a successful business. By studying operations management, you can learn the skills and knowledge that are needed to oversee the production and distribution of goods and services, and to ensure that they are produced and delivered in a timely and efficient manner.
- Studying operations management can help you to develop a range of valuable skills, including problem-solving, critical thinking, and decision-making. These skills are highly sought after by employers, and can help to open up a wide range of career opportunities.
- Operations management is a field that is constantly evolving, and there is a growing demand for professionals who have the skills and knowledge to keep up with the latest developments. By studying operations management, you can stay up-to-date with the latest trends and technologies, and position yourself as a valuable asset to potential employers.
- Studying operations management can also help you to develop a broad understanding of business and management, which can be useful in a wide range of industries and sectors. This knowledge can be applied to a variety of settings, from manufacturing and logistics to healthcare and retail.
- Operations management is a field that offers a wide range of career opportunities, with many different paths to choose from. Whether you are interested in working in a large corporation, a small business, or even starting your own company, studying operations management can help you to prepare for a fulfilling and rewarding career.
